#1.avg() 因为存在一个员工,多条薪资记录的情况,所以需要先分组统计sc.sql('''SELECT AVG(a.income) FROM ( SELECT SUM(income) AS income FROM test_youhua.test_avg_medium_freq GROUP BY name ) AS a''').show()#2.sum/人数sc.sql('''SELECT SUM(income)/COUNT(DISTINCT name) AS avg_income ...
because COUNT(*) would have to read all columns of each row (just like executing a SELECT * FROM MYTABLE statement), while COUNT(columnname) only need to read the specified column. This is not true though, for several reasons.
摘要:select count(字段) from 表名; #得到字段中is not null的行数 select count(*)from 表名; #任何列,只要有一个非null就会被统计上。全为null(不会出现该情况)则不被统计。用于统计表的行数 select count(1) from 表名; #统阅读全文 posted @2019-03-06 02:35Holy_Shit阅读(1700)评论(0)推荐(...
I don't think you need to have the aggregate function (COUNT(*) AS Lesson_Count) as part of the select statement but it's often "nice to have" to give you the confidence that your results are as you would expect. Your query is actually failing because the subquery doesn't have a F...
自定义SQL查询结果是通过在SELECT语句中嵌套一个子查询来实现的。子查询可以作为SELECT语句中的一个列,返回一个结果集作为查询的一部分。 在自定义SQL查询结果中,可以使用子查询来获取额外的...
下面的SQL查询有问题: SELECT job FROM (SELECT job, COUNT(*) AS cnt FROM Employee GROUP BY job) WHERE cnt=1 因此,它应该只显示cnt (作业计数)等于1的所有作业。当我在Fiddle上测试上面的select查询时,我得到以下错误: Incorrect syntax near the keyword 'WHERE'. SQLFiddle: 浏览8提问于2016-04-01...
SQLRowCount返回缓存的行计数值。 缓存的行计数值在语句句柄设置回准备或分配的状态、重新执行语句或调用SQLCloseCursor之前有效。 请注意,如果自设置SQL_DIAG_ROW_COUNT字段后调用了函数,则 SQLRowCount返回的值可能与SQL_DIAG_ROW_COUNT字段中的值不同,因为任何函数调用都会将SQL_DIAG_ROW_COUNT...
BENCHMARK(count,expr) benchmark函数会重复计算expr表达式count次,所以我们可以尽可能多的增加计算的次数来增加时间延迟,如下: 可以看到通过重复计算延时了1.90s 笛卡尔积盲注 注入姿势 mysql>SELECTcount(*)FROMinformation_schema.columnsA,information_schema.columnsB,information_schema.tablesC;+---+|count(*)|+-...
25 Data Warehouse Service SQL Syntax 3 Keyword Keyword RIGHT ROLE ROLLBACK ROLLUP ROUTINE ROUTINE_CATALOG ROUTINE_NAME ROUTINE_SCHEMA ROW ROWS ROW_COUNT RULE SAVEPOINT SCALE SCHEMA SCHEMA_NAME SCOPE SCROLL SEARCH SECOND SECTION SECURITY SELECT SELF GaussDB(DWS) Reserved (functions and types allowed) ...
Basic syntax for the COUNT() function in its simplest form is in the following example: SELECT COUNT(*) FROM TableName; GO This simple query will return (count) the total number of rows in a table. That's about as basic as it gets with the COUNT function in T-SQL. ...